This property is located in Whitchurch, a village in Herefordshire that lies on the A40, connecting Ross‑on‑Wye to the Welsh town of Monmouth. It sits within the Wye Valley, a designated national landscape featuring the River Wye.
Whitchurch, Herefordshire is a village positioned on the A40, linking the nearby town of Ross‑on‑Wye with the Welsh town of Monmouth. The locality lies within the Wye Valley, a national landscape that follows the River Wye. The River Wye is the fourth‑longest river in the UK, extending about 250 kilometres from its source on Plynlimon in mid Wales to the Severn Estuary. The lower reaches of the river form part of the England‑Wales border. The Wye Valley is important for nature conservation and recreation, but the river is affected by pollution. The village’s setting in this valley offers a rural character and access to the natural environment of the Wye Valley.
